Ringgit Hits Strongest Level in Over Four Years at 4.1000

KUALA LUMPUR – The ringgit opened stronger at 4.1000/1100 against the US dollar on Friday, its best level since April 28, 2021. The local currency extended gains after the US data showed a softening labour market and the Federal Reserve delivered an expected 25-basis-point rate cut.

The US Dollar Index dropped 0.44 per cent to 98.348. Traders expect the ringgit to hover near the key 4.10 psychological level today. Against major currencies, it weakened versus the pound (5.4911/5045), euro (4.8138/8256) and yen (2.6368/6434). Performance was mixed against ASEAN peers.
